Optimizer allows you to filter your schedule view by the following criteria, Workgroup, Team, Interaction Type, Skill set, Shift, Shift Trade. If you are simply looking to evaluate how many resources you have schedule for a given criteria, say location in your example you could create a logical workgroup or perhaps skill (meaning no interactions routing to them). You can use them to filter your schedule. Keep in mind this is for filtering purposes only as you will not have forecast data for these grouping because you are not actually forecasting for them. This is a work around to simply see schedules for a subset but not for evaluation of coverage.
